Consider requiring mitigation of script injection attacks. #133

In #109, @RByers noted that mandatory encryption could be a path towards mitigating the risk that unexpected/injected code on a site could enable an attacker to extract details of a user's identity.

I'd suggest a) that that risk is real, and b) that you could mitigate it to some extent by requiring the page on which the API executes to have at least minimal defenses against injection attacks by requiring a sufficiently-strong CSP along the lines of https://mikewest.github.io/injection-mitigated/.
